Traces of Hecke operators on Drinfeld modular forms for GL2(Fq[T])$\operatorname{GL}_2(\mathbb {F}_q[T])$

open access: yesMathematika, Volume 72, Issue 2, April 2026.
Abstract In this paper, we study traces of Hecke operators on Drinfeld modular forms of level 1 in the case A=Fq[T]$A = \mathbb {F}_q[T]$. We deduce closed‐form expressions for traces of Hecke operators corresponding to primes of degree at most 2 and provide algorithms for primes of higher degree.

Zarankiewicz bounds from distal regularity lemma

open access: yesBulletin of the London Mathematical Society, Volume 58, Issue 3, March 2026.
Abstract Since Kővári, Sós and Turán proved upper bounds for the Zarankiewicz problem in 1954, much work has been undertaken to improve these bounds, and some have done so by restricting to particular classes of graphs. A Matrix Approach for Divisibility Properties of the Generalized Fibonacci Sequence

open access: yesDiscrete Dynamics in Nature and Society, 2013
We give divisibility properties of the generalized Fibonacci sequence by matrix methods. We also present new recursive identities for the generalized Fibonacci and Lucas sequences.
